New York Neuro and Rehab Center is a rehabilitation center located in New York, New York, dedicated to providing specialized care for individuals recovering from neurological conditions and injuries. Situated....
- 4470 Broadway
- New York
- New York
- 10040 (zip code)
- 4470 Broadway
- New York
- New York
- 10040 (zip code)


































